Diplocentrum recurvum Lindl.

 
  • Family : ORCHIDACEAE
    (Orchid Family)
  • Family (Hindi name) : ORCHID FAMILY (ऑर्चिड फैमिली)
  • Family (as per The APG System III) : ORCHIDACEAE
  • Species Name (as per The Plant List) : Diplocentrum recurvum Lindl.
  • Habit : Herb
  • Habitat : Evergreen and moist deciduous forests
  • Comments / notes : Scarce on trees; Often on hills above 1200m,as an epiphyte.
  • Flower, Fruit : May-July
  • Distribution :
    • Andhra Pradesh : Chittoor district
    • Karnataka : Kolar district, Mysuru district, Shivamogga district
    • Kerala : Palakkad district, Idukki district
    • Maharashtra : Pune district, Sindhudurg district
    • Tamil Nadu : Dindigul district
  • Native : India
  • World Distribution : India, Sri Lanka
  • Conservation Status : Not Evaluated (NE)
